Abstract | A novel transparent Tapered Slot Antenna is proposed in this paper. Since the approval by the FCC in 2002, much research has been undertaken on UWB especially for wireless communications. Often times especially for devices where internet services are required, UWB is complemented with the 2.4 GHz WLAN service like in Laptops or notebooks instead of being filtered out. In this paper, a transparent Tapered Slot Antenna (TSA) covering the frequency range from 2.1 GHz to 10.8 GHz is designed and fabricated using AgHT-8 for use in Laptop applications. The antenna provides sufficient gain, reasonable efficiency and a good return loss. |
